A storm system will thicken clouds over the area Thursday with rain following Thursday night.  The northern and northwestern edge of that rain will have to be watched for snow that night.  During the day Friday, winds will shift around to support more pure snow over the area accompanied by a small disturbance will likely lay down a several inches of snow.  I’ll post a snow projection map on the news tonight.

A more robust storm will affect the area beginning Sunday evening and lasting through Monday evening.  This looks to be leaning toward all snow again especially on Monday.  It is too early to project totals with confidence on this storm yet.
